Venus Tribella

At Base Skin, TriBella offers a comprehensive skin renewal experience by combining three powerful procedures into one treatment. This transformative approach delivers remarkably smoother, younger-looking, and healthier skin. With its high-intensity yet non-invasive nature, TriBella ensures visible results in fewer sessions. The TriBella photofacial (IPL) targets discoloration, age spots, sun damage, and improves overall skin tone. Next, the anti-aging component (Diamond Polar) minimizes fine lines, wrinkles, and enhances skin firmness. Finally, the skin resurfacing aspect (VIVA) addresses uneven texture, scars, enlarged pores, stretch marks, and other textural concerns. For optimal outcomes, we recommend a series of 2-3 treatments spaced 4-6 weeks apart, followed by maintenance sessions every 6-12 months to preserve your results.

  • What is the downtime?
    Some patients may experience slight redness, swelling and tenderness on the treated areas ranging from a few hours up to a few days. There may also follow temporary bruising and numbness on the areas treated which should resolve over a week or two. However most of the time you should experience no visible downtime.
